Patient Care Liaison
in Healthcare + Life Sciences ContractJob Detail
Job Description
Overview
- Serve as a Patient Care Liaison, ensuring smooth transitions for patients into care settings while collaborating with healthcare professionals.
- Coordinate patient admissions, working closely with physicians, social workers, and case managers to ensure optimal care delivery.
- Provide compassionate support to patients and families during transitions, addressing concerns and enhancing satisfaction.
- Engage in outreach activities to promote services to hospitals and community organizations, fostering professional relationships.
- Contribute to marketing initiatives, including social media campaigns, to enhance visibility and community engagement.
- Participate in organizing educational programs and community events to strengthen organizational presence.
- Ensure adherence to healthcare policies and procedures, maintaining compliance and high standards of care.
Key Responsibilities & Duties
- Conduct daily hospital visits to establish and maintain relationships with healthcare professionals, including social workers and case managers.
- Act as a liaison between healthcare providers and agency staff, ensuring effective communication and coordination.
- Develop and implement strategies to promote services and enhance community outreach.
- Organize and deliver presentations to community groups and healthcare organizations, showcasing services and benefits.
- Collaborate with local hospitals, physician offices, and assisted living facilities to build robust networks.
- Plan and execute community relations activities to enhance the organization's presence and reputation.
- Ensure effective oral and written communication to facilitate clear and professional interactions.
- Adapt to dynamic healthcare environments, addressing challenges and ensuring smooth operations.
Job Requirements
- Associate of Arts (AA) degree or equivalent educational background required.
- Minimum of 1 year of experience in patient care liaison roles or similar settings.
- Proven ability to network with healthcare providers and community organizations effectively.
- Knowledge of communication principles, marketing strategies, and community relations practices.
- Strong organizational skills and ability to present ideas to diverse audiences confidently.
- Excellent oral and written communication skills for professional interactions.
- Proficiency in planning and executing social media and outreach campaigns.
- Flexibility to work on-site and adapt to dynamic healthcare environments.
